I just inherited my first LR, an '04 D2 130K with a blown head gasket, etc. However, after I had removed a few components, I noticed the 'mystery' vac or vent line wasn't connected to anything. Should it be disconnected? Location: The line enters the engine bay via the front driver's side wheel well; travels horizontallly along the firewall (clipped to firewall) toward the center and stops.
